Concomitant administration of radiotherapy with cisplatin or radiotherapy with cetuximab appear to be the treatment of choice for patients with locally advanced head and neck cancer. In the present retrospective analysis, we investigated the predictive role of several biomarkers in an unselected cohort of patients treated with concomitant radiotherapy, weekly cisplatin, and cetuximab (CCRT). We identified 37 patients treated with this approach, of which 13 (35%) achieved a complete response and 10 (27%) achieved a partial response. Severe side effects were mainly leucopenia,
dysphagia
, rash, and anemia. Tumor
EGFR
, MET, ERCC1, and p-53 protein and/or gene expression were not associated with treatment response. In contrast, high MMP9 mRNA expression was found to be significantly associated with objective response. In conclusion, CCRT is feasible and active. MMP9 was the only biomarker tested that appears to be of predictive value in cetuximab treated patients. However, this is a hypothesis generating study and the results should not be viewed as definitive evidence until they are validated in a larger cohort.

Mucoepidermoid carcinoma of the lung is exceedingly rare. Our case involves a 58-year-old male who presented with shortness of breath,
dysphagia
, and weight loss. He denied ever smoking. Chest x-ray revealed trapped lung, and CT demonstrated a right bronchial mass. Diagnosis of lung carcinoma was made by bronchoscopic FNA biopsy.
EGFR
mutation was negative. Staging workup demonstrated evidence of advanced disease. Performance status was good, and it was decided to start chemotherapy and radiation for palliation. Lung carcinomas often present as an obstructing hilar mass. There are different histological grades that affect progression and survival. Though uncommon, metastatic spread has been previously reported. Studies have investigated the possible role of tyrosine kinase inhibitors in both
EGFR
-mutated and non-mutated cases. Unfortunately, there has been little consensus as to which therapies are most beneficial.

Nivolumab is an immune checkpoint inhibitor with demonstrated efficacy against several malignant tumors. Alterations in driver oncogenes such as
EGFR
and
ALK
are a poor prognostic factor in nivolumab therapy for non-small cell lung cancer (NSCLC), whereas a smoking history is a well-known, favorable prognostic factor. However, an efficacy of nivolumab therapy for multiple primary malignant tumors (MPMTs) has not been reported, and its efficacy for driver oncogene-positive NSCLC in smokers is unclear. Herein, we report the case of a patient with a history of heavy smoking who developed synchronous
ALK
-positive NSCLC and gastric cancer that responded to nivolumab therapy. A 76-year-old man who was a heavy smoker presented to our hospital with symptoms of hoarseness and
dysphagia
. He was ultimately diagnosed with
ALK
-positive advanced NSCLC. An ALK inhibitor (alectinib) was administered, and the lung cancer lesions showed improvement. The alectinib therapy was continued for 5 months. Thereafter, the lesions in the left lower lobe of the lung showed regrowth. During the same period, the patient experienced epigastric pain. Gastrointestinal endoscopy examination revealed gastric cancer. He was administered nivolumab to treat both the lung cancer and the gastric cancer. Two months later, both the lung lesions and the gastric lesions had diminished in size. Nivolumab therapy might be an effective therapy for synchronous MPMTs and NSCLC in heavy smokers, even if the lung cancer possesses driver oncogene mutations.
